Post Pertronix problem

reading instructions carefully... my ignitor did NOT fit as advertised and so i called. they need a distributor number... where do i find it? or what alternative distributor might i have in my 1960 292? Thanks, Pete

The Ford part number on the distributor is located on the side just below the cap, opposite side of the vacuum port. The number has 3 parts. The first is a date code then the basic part number and then the revision. The one in my hand is B9CF 12127 K. The first to digits B9 gives the the year of manufcture 1959. B is for the decade 50 and 9 is the year in that decade 59. Since you have a 1960 truck you should expect to see a B9 or C0 at the begining if it is the original part for your engine. If it has been replaced it could be about any thing from 1954 to 1964. Just to let you know, if the part number is earlier than 1957 then you have a vacuum advance only distributor, no mechanical advance. That would not be good and could be why the Pertronix did not fit. I installed a Pertronix on my 1959 distributor and it fit just fine. Just as the directions said.
